The MiBook is sooo close to being a true ebook reader it is sad. Other have mentioned the ability to play music display pictures and video files. None of this is new, these all features of any modern electronic picture frame. The addition of a battery and the ability to read a text file bring the MiBook very close to being a decent ebook reader.

The battery life while viewing a text file is not great but seems to be decent, the size and weight are acceptable, the page turning is smooth and I did not find the slight flicker to be tiring or detract from the reading experiencing.

There are only two things keeping the miBook from being a Sony or Kindle killer. This is the lack of bookmarks and the ability to navigate through a file beyond turning a page. This would not be a problem if you read a book from start to finish in one sitting. Without these features, forget it.
The mibook does not remember your position in a file you are reading so every time you turn it on and open a book, you start at page 1 and have to page through the book one page at a time until you find the last page you read. The addition of bookmarks and/or the ability to move through the file in mylti-page jumps would correct this.
Until there is an upgrade or a hack to address these two problems the Mibook is worthless as a reader, Great for looking at pretty pictures but...
